GMAS Grade 6 Practice – with Information Extended Response Writing
This collection features reading and writing practice aligned to the Georgia Milestones Assessment System (GMAS) for Grade 6. Each practice assessment includes a reading selection or text set followed by questions featuring a mix of multiple choice questions and other item types as well as a Short Constructed Response prompt. The practice assessments also include an Extended Constructed Response question in the Information genre. Student-friendly answer feedback is provided for each question. Use the assessments in this collection for formative reading and writing practice on a variety of skills aligned to Georgia Standards of Excellence.

Georgia Grade 6-8: Teacher Calibration for GMAS
This collection of assignments, complete with the GMAS rubric, provides sample student work along with corresponding scores and rationales. The primary objective of these Item and Scoring Samplers is to offer exemplars of the constructed-response items found on the End of Grade (EOG) and End of Course (EOC) assessments for English Language Arts as part of the Georgia Milestones. These assignments are exclusively for teachers (not for use with students) and can be utilized in a Team Grade Event with a group or independently by the teacher.
